This painting was very difficult to make. Its title is a quote from Mia Schem, an October 7th Nova festival hostage survivor. The painting features around 1200+ Magen Davids (Star of Davids) on the top and dancing around the girl, to represent the 1200+ Israeli lives taken from us on October 7th. On the bottom are around 253 Magen Davids, representing the hostages taken on October 7th, many of whom are still waiting to return home. The girl is dancing among them, signifying that even in the darkness, we will dance again, and we will dance for those who cannot anymore. 1200+ lives is hard to conceptualize, but when you start drawing each individual Magen David, you start to realize just how many lives were cut short. It felt like I was drawing Magen Davids for weeks and weeks. 

 

Each one was someone’s daughter, son, mother, father, child, sister, brother, grandmother, cousin, aunt, uncle, friend. Each one was everything to someone. We will never forget them, and we will live in memory of them. We will also never stop defending ourselves and showing the world that we are the light in the darkness, and that we will dance again.

 

Profits from the prints of this painting are being donated to One Family, an organization that financially and emotionally supports the victims of terror in Israel.
